Transaction 68297294efee9175ccb2d7b4af7badb79a852f560f607747fc4cb2ffb20eec7e
1 Input
1 Output
-
68297294efee9175ccb2d7b4af7badb79a852f560f607747fc4cb2ffb20eec7e:0
- value
- 2137701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72e477b891ebc7b793d12528d75746eddd14f660 OP_EQUAL
- address
- 3CAWed8W9ShsKQTpwUaoDv3hpQx2ShFaQf